Key Technical Parameters
| Parameter | Specification |
|---|---|
| Manufacturer | General Electric (GE) |
| Series | Mark V (Speedtronic) |
| Full Model | DS3800NOAB1C1B |
| Power Supply | +5V DC @ 4.0A, +15V DC @ 0.7A, -15V DC @ 0.5A |
| Temperature Inputs | 8 thermocouple channels (Type J/K/T, 16-bit ADC, ±1°C accuracy) |
| SS Outputs | 8 solid-state relays, 2A continuous @ 24–48VDC |
| Relay Outputs | 4 mechanical relays, 3A continuous @ 115VAC/30VDC (surge 5A) |
| Tachometer Inputs | 2 channels (up to 10 kHz) |
| Communication | Mark V proprietary parallel backplane bus |
| Operating Temperature | -20°C to +65°C |
| LED Indicators | Power, SS Run (8x green), Relay Run (4x amber), Tach Fail (red x2), Over-Temp Alarm, Backplane Active |

Comparison with Related Models
| Feature | DS3800NOAB1C1B | DS3800NOAB (Base) | DS3800NOAA1F1D | DS3800NMSA1B1A |
|---|---|---|---|---|
| SS Outputs | 8 × 2A | 8 × 2A | 8 × 3A | 8 × 2A |
| Relay Outputs | 4 × 3A | 4 × 3A | 4 × 5A | 4 × 3A |
| T/C Inputs | 8 | 8 | 4 + 8 = 12 | 8 |
| Tach Inputs | 2 channels | 2 channels | 2 channels | None |
| ADC Resolution | 16-bit (±1°C) | 12-bit (±2°C) | 24-bit (±0.5°C) | 16-bit (±1°C) |
| Predictive Maintenance | No | No | Yes | No |
| Operating Temp | -20°C to +65°C | 0°C to +60°C | -40°C to +85°C | 0°C to +60°C |
| Firmware | C | A/B | F | B |
| Cost | Medium | Medium | Ultra-Premium | Medium |

Critical Precautions
-
ESD Protection: Always wear a grounded wrist strap.
-
DC Polarity (SS): Solid-state outputs are DC-only and polarity-sensitive—reverse polarity destroys the MOSFET.
-
SS Voltage Limit: Do not exceed 48VDC—AC voltages cause catastrophic failure.
-
High-Voltage/Current Hazard (Relay): Relay outputs switch 115VAC/3A—lethal. Use proper insulation.
-
Relay Inductive Derating: For inductive loads, derate from 3A to 2A or use RC snubbers.
-
Tachometer Wiring: Use shielded twisted-pair cable. Connect shield to designated terminal—not at the fan end.
-
No Hot-Swap: Always depower the rack before insertion/removal.
-
Slot Assignment: Install in slots 8–10 (auxiliary I/O).
-
CPU Dependency: If backplane communication is lost, the board defaults to 100% fan speed—tachometer monitoring disabled in fallback mode.
-
Firmware Compatibility: Revision C firmware is compatible with Mark V CPU firmware v4.0 and above. For v3.x, the enhanced ADC features may be partially disabled—confirm compatibility before purchasing.
